How they compare

Greece currently reports 26.2% against 25.7% in Korea, a difference of 0.5%.

The two have swapped places 11 times across 63 shared years of data; in 1962 it was Korea ahead.

Greece ranks 24th and Korea ranks 26th of 196 countries.

Across the 7 decades both report, Greece averaged higher in 4 and Korea in 3.

Head to head by decade

Decade Greece Korea Difference Ahead
1960s 7.7% 6.4% 1.3% Greece
1970s 15.6% 14.0% 1.6% Greece
1980s 20.1% 21.9% 1.8% Korea
1990s 8.4% 17.0% 8.6% Korea
2000s 16.0% 25.5% 9.5% Korea
2010s 29.5% 28.6% 0.9% Greece
2020s 26.9% 24.6% 2.3% Greece

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

Fuels comprise the commodities in SITC (Rev. 3) section 3 (mineral fuels, lubricants and related materials). This indicator is expressed as a percentage of merchandise imports which is comprised of goods whose economic ownership is changed between a non-resident and a resident and that are not included in the following specific categories: goods under merchanting, non-monetary gold, and parts of travel, construction, and government goods and services n.i.e.
